Summary

1. We performed analytic calculation of the vacuum polarization tensor in constant magnetic fields.

2. We obtained precise behaviors of the refractive index in LLL. Magnitudes of B-fields, Photon energy, Propagation angle, polarization

3. We discussed possible applications to UrHIC and Neutron Stars/Magnetars.

We showed anisotropic and polarization-dependent photon spectruminduced by the Landau levels in strong B-fields.
